Champions Cup rugby club Stade Francais has said it is the victim of a cyber attack, with reports stating players’ identity documents are being held to ransom. Cybercriminals have reportedly threatened to release documents relating to players, having already unveiled a number of identifiable documents belonging to 18 players. “Immediate containment, investigation and recovery measures [...]
